I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DSns DANGER Failure to follow the Dangers, Warnings and Cautions contained in this Owner's Manual may result in serious bodily injury or death, or in fire or an explosion causing damage to property. 3 WARNINGS: m WARNING: Do not use charcoal or other combustible fuels in this grill. This grill is not designed 4 for charcoal use and a fire could result.
